Tottenham have a firm position on Cristian Romero amid Atletico Madrid interest
Tottenham Hotspur’s stance on Cristian Romero’s future has now emerged following interest from Atletico Madrid.
Cristian Romero often comes across as a frustrated figure at Tottenham Hotspur, with the Spurs captain not shy about voicing his discontent.
Romero recently labelled the lack of fit Spurs players in the game against Manchester City as disgraceful, just after the January transfer window slammed shut.
Since his last comments, reports have emerged suggesting Romero wants out of Tottenham in the summer, and he has not been short of suitors.
Tottenham stance on Cristian Romero transfer interest revealed
According to Football Insider, Atletico Madrid have once again shown interest in Romero after their attempts to sign the Tottenham man failed last summer.
Romero instead put pen to paper on a new contract rather than heading out the door in north London following Tottenham’s Europa League success.
However, despite Atletico Madrid showing interest in the Argentine, it is understood Spurs still have no interest in losing their captain, regardless of his volatile nature.
But the Lilywhites may not have it all their own way, as the report warns that player power could come into play as the 27-year-old seeks Champions League football.
Romero ambition poses Spurs dilemma
Romero is certainly a player with ambition, and it is clear to see that Tottenham are not matching his desires at the moment.
However, recent reports have claimed that the Spurs’ higher-ups have reassured their captain that there are plans for a ‘significant rebuild’ of the squad in the summer, amid rumours that he wants out of Tottenham.
Spurs finished 17th last term and are on course for yet another bottom-half finish as they sit 16th in the Premier League, with five points separating them from the relegation places.
That means, unless they win the Champions League, Tottenham will not feature in Europe next term, making it even harder to keep a player like Romero, who is looking to play in Europe’s premier competition.
